A Batting Order Built for Success
Gill’s comments emphasize the impact of India’s deep batting order. The presence of batting legends like Rohit Sharma and Virat Kohli provides a solid foundation, allowing the younger players more freedom. Consistent contributions from Shreyas Iyer, KL Rahul, Hardik Pandya, and Ravindra Jadeja offer a powerful safety net. This depth allows the top order to play aggressively, knowing that reliable support is always available.
Adaptability and Flexibility
This batting lineup isn’t just deep; it’s remarkably flexible. India can adjust their approach based on the match situation, seamlessly shifting from controlled powerplay innings to aggressive chases. The fact that Jadeja, typically batting at number eight, has barely needed to bat in the Champions Trophy underscores the sheer strength of the batting order. This flexibility allows India to tackle any challenge with confidence.
Calculated Risks and Match Intensity
Gill’s personal approach emphasizes calculated risk-taking over reckless aggression. He highlights the importance of being ‘in the zone’ – a state of intense focus enabling intuitive decision-making. This focus isn’t just about hitting boundaries; it’s about smart singles and maintaining pressure. This calculated approach is perfectly suited to the slower pitches often found in Dubai, where steady progress is often more valuable than explosive hitting.
